"d"]) print("data_1:", data_1) print("data_2:", data_2) data_3 = pd.concat([data_...
df_merge_inner=pd.merge(df1,df2,on='ID',how='inner')print(df_merge_inner) 三、连接数据框 连接是指将两个或多个数据框按照行方向或列方向进行连接,形成一个更大的数据框。在 Python 中,可以使用 pandas 库提供的 concat() 函数来实现数据框的连接。下面是一个简单示例: 代码语言:javascript 代码运行...
join_datas.to_excel(writer)print("数据保存完毕!!") 2. concat方法中指定轴axis=1实现表格左右合并 #%%concat_datas =pd.concat( [df01,df02], axis=1, ignore_index=True, )#%%concat_datas.columns = ["性别","住址","电话"]#设置列名concat_datas.fillna("",inplace=True)#把NaN值转为空with ...
concat([data1,data2,data3],axis=0) #按照行进行拼接数据 # data.head(5) data.dropna(axis=1,inplace=True) #按照列删除na列,并且修改源数据 data.info() 简单统计 接下来我们进行数据的简单统计 统计卖出菜品的平均价格 代码语言:javascript 代码运行次数:0 运行 AI代码解释 round(data['amounts']....
【Python】【Pandas】使用concat添加行 添加行 t = pd.DataFrame(columns=["姓名","平均分"]) t = t.append({"姓名":"小红","平均分":M1},ignore_index=True) t = t.append({"姓名":"张明","平均分":M2},ignore_index=True) t = t.append({"姓名":"小江","平均分":M3},ignore_index=True...
File"/Users/sammy/Documents/github/journaldev/Python-3/basic_examples/strings/string_concat_int.py", line5,in<module>print(current_year_message + current_year)TypeError: can only concatenate str(not"int")to str Copy So how do you concatenatestrandintin Python? There are various other ways to...
age = 38 name = "Annie" print(f'his name is {name},{age} years old') #his name is Annie,38 years old 字符串操作 自动字符串连接 Python中,如果你将两个字符串字面值放在一起,它们会自动被连接: python auto_concat = 'hello' ' world' # 结果: "hello world" 查找与替换 使用find()方法...
同时,我们还对整个数据处理流程进行了可视化,以帮助读者更好地理解过程。 数据合并在数据科学和数据分析中是一个非常基础和重要的步骤。如果您有更复杂的合并需求,比如处理缺失值、去重复等,可以考虑使用更高级的Pandas功能,比如merge、concat等。 希望本文对您理解和实现Python数据合并有所帮助。如有疑问,请随时提问!
sheet_name=0,converters={'学号':str})# 将Excel文件导入到DataFrame变量中df=df[:5] #截取df的前5个记录print(df) #输出dfdf1=df[:3] #截取df的前3个记录存入df1中df2=df[3:5] #截取df的最后2个记录存入df2中df3=pandas.concat([df2,df1]) #将df2与df1合并存入df3中print(df3...
FutureWarning: The frame.append method is deprecated and will be removed from pandas in a future version. Use pandas.concat instead. 于是我就按它提示的来。 concat是将两个DataFrame拼接起来 td = pd.DataFrame([{"姓名":"小红","平均分":"%.2f"%M1},{"姓名":"张明","平均分":"%.2f"%M2}...